Recipe - Oven Fried Eggplant

Categories: None, Oven Fried Eggplant
Ingredients:

6 tablespoon All Purpose Flour
One fourth cup Wheat Germ, Toasted
3 tablespoon Sesame Seeds
One fourth teaspoon Salt
2 lg Eggs, Whites Only
1 tablespoon Water
1 lg Eggplant, Peeled & Sliced
1/4" Thick
2 tablespoon Olive Oil
1 Lemon, Quartered
Kosher Salt

Preheat the oven to 450 degrees. Place the eggplant slices in a colander
over a large bowl. Heavily salt the eggplant slices with kosher salt. Cover
with a towel. Let stand for 30 minutes. Lightly grease a baking sheet.
Combine the flour, wheat germ, sesame seeds and salt on a large, flat
plate. Stir the egg whites and water together in a shallow bowl. Dip each
eggplant slice into the egg white mixture. Roll each slice in the flour
mixture. Place the coated slices on the baking sheet. Drizzle olive oil
over the coated slices. Bake for 10 minutes. Reduce the oven temperature to
400 degrees. Bake for another 10 minutes. Turn the eggplant slices over.
Bake until crisp and golden on the outside and tender on the inside (about
10 minutes longer).

Serve with lemon wedges. ~~~ Sherri Eastman
